The Participatory Rural Appraisal (PRA) tools, such as key informant interviews and focused group discussions, were used to explore the perceptions of local communities on the causes of livelihood transformation and its impact on the well-being of pastoralists and their overall survival. Purposive sampling was used to administer key informant interviews and FGDs. The findings of this study indicate that the foremost causes of livelihoods transformation in Dhas district include frequent drought and environmental degradation, pastoralists’ sedentarisation policies and conflict over boundary and grazing lands. Previously, pastoralism livelihood system was the most viable strategy in the study area providing sustainable livestock products, while, at the same time, protecting water and rangeland resources and safeguarding environment warrant the Borana pastoralist’s well-being. However, with the changing livelihood dynamics, the Borana’s pastoral system underwent major upheavals, enfeebling the pragmatism of these practices. Out of the three, Mendoza province has the highest number of goats in the country. This system of production is majorly managed by the family members making it an integral part of the Family Farming sector.. This type of production generates work in a pauperized sector and at such places that are distant from the urban centres where possibility of alternative occupations is scare or almost nil. The animal rearing activity focuses on primary production with little value addition, high seasonality, and informal and rudimentary marketing strategies. These activities primarily employ tacit knowledge acquired over the years by trial-and-error method. Transhumance, as a strategy for the use of the natural environment, reveals the existence of a thorough knowledge of the seasonal productivity of the grasslands of the mountain valleys. Research and extension organizations develop projects aimed at improving these production systems through the implementation of contemporary technologies.
